Initial one-time containment and campaign setup is substantial (~$7.94M), driven primarily by containment case construction, research and development, media/PR suppression, legal retainer, and contingency reserves. Recurring annual costs are significant (~$5.16M/yr), dominated by homeowner compensation, legal/takedown operations, and staff wages.

Cost Scenarios
📊 Baseline (baseline) $5.2M/yr
82.0% probability / year
Normal year with scheduled removals, monitoring, and ongoing research/operations but no major incidents or public exposures.
routine_removals ongoing_research normal_takedown_volume
🚨 Minor Incident $5.9M/yr
15.0% probability / year +$750K vs baseline
Localized public exposure or small breach requiring emergency removals, PR surge, and additional legal/takedown actions.
localized_public_exposure additional_removals temporary_PR_surge
🚨 Major Breach $8.7M/yr
3.0% probability / year +$3.5M vs baseline
Widespread viral exposure, mass instances or litigation cascade requiring large-scale buyouts, emergency containment expansion, and intensive legal/PR operations.
viral_spread mass_public_exposure large_scale_litigation
